WebApr 13, 2024 · Arteries carry oxygenated blood away from the heart, while veins carry deoxygenated blood back to the heart. Arteries have thicker walls and a smaller lumen than veins. Arteries have a pulse and a high-pressure blood flow, while veins have a steady flow and low pressure. WebCapillaries Capillaries are the smallest blood vessels. They are the site of gas and nutrient exchange between the circulatory system and tissues. Blood flows from arterioles to capillaries and then onwards to small venules and then larger veins. According to the Cleveland Clinic, if you laid out all of the blood vessels in the circulatory system, they would ... sherif yacoubWebVeins are blood vessels located throughout your body that collect oxygen-poor blood and return it to your heart. Veins are part of your circulatory system. They work together with other blood vessels and your heart to keep your blood moving. Veins hold most of the blood in your body.
